Error: Winsock 2.0 must be installed

If you're getting an error message saying that Winsock 2.0 must be installed, you are running Windows 95 and must install Microsoft Windows Socket 2.0 in order to run BlueLight Internet. You will also want to verify that you are using the latest version of Microsoft Dial-Up Networking.

Possible Solutions
A. Install Windows Socket 2.0
B. Update to the latest version of Dial-Up Networking
C. Uninstall and Reinstall BlueLight Internet

The following instructions will help guide you through this process. We recommend that you try these steps using an alternate Internet service provider on your computer.


A. Install Windows Socket 2.0

B. Update to the Latest Version of Dial-Up Networking

The version of Microsoft Dial-Up Networking that shipped with Windows 95 is not compatible with BlueLight Internet. If you have never updated Dial-Up Networking, you must update to the latest version. For detailed instructions, click here.


C. Uninstall and Reinstall BlueLight Internet

If you previously installed BlueLight Internet, you will need to uninstall and reinstall it after installing Winsock 2.0.

To uninstall BlueLight Internet:

  1. Click on the Windows Start button, point to Settings and select Control Panel.
  2. Double-click on the Add/Remove Programs icon.
  3. Click once on BlueLight Internet to highlight it and click on the Add/Remove button.
  4. Click OK then OK again and close the Control Panel.
  5. Click on the Windows Start button, point to Programs and select Windows Explorer.
  6. Double-click the Program Files folder in the left-side window.
  7. If you see a BlueLight Internet folder, highlight it and press the Delete key on your keyboard to remove it.
    NOTE: If a BlueLight Internet folder does not exist, you can skip to step 12.
  8. Close Windows Explorer.
  9. Double-click the My Computer icon on your desktop.
  10. Double-click the Dial-Up Networking icon.
  11. Click once on the BlueLight Internet icon to highlight it and press the Delete key on your keyboard to remove it.
  12. Restart the computer, and then reinstall the latest version of BlueLight Internet.
